BS 7858 Security Screening Course Certification

This online training course has been specifically developed to provide a cost effective online training delivery solution for the BS 7858 Skills for Security accredited achievement certification. You can study at your own pace, in office or at home. Each course has a time limit that has been set knowing that most learners will complete the course before the maximum time. Once succsefully completed you will be asked to provide an address where your certificate will be delieverd by recorded post.

  • Skills for Security

    Skills for Security Accredited Certificate

    BS7858 Standard - Security Screening online course with recognised certification once completed. This qualification will also help those looking to improve their C.V and employment prospects. This award prepares delegates who are required to implement security screening procedures as part of their employment or company duties.
